Understanding Breast Lift Surgery
A breast lift, medically known as mastopexy, is a specialized plastic surgery procedure designed to raise and reshape sagging breasts. As women age, skin loses elasticity, causing breasts to lose their natural shape and firmness. This surgical technique elevates the breasts, restoring a more youthful and contoured appearance.
Reasons for Considering a Breast Lift
- Elevate breasts affected by aging and gravitational changes
- Restore breast firmness after pregnancy and breastfeeding
- Reposition nipples and areolas that point downward or sideways
- Restore breast suppleness following significant weight loss
Surgical Techniques
Kelamis Plastic Surgery offers comprehensive breast lift procedures typically lasting between one and a half to three hours. The most common technique involves an anchor-like incision along the breast's underside, allowing precise reshaping and repositioning.
Advanced Procedural Options
Patients with minimal sagging may qualify for modified procedures requiring less extensive incisions. Innovative techniques include minimal incision methods and specialized nipple sensation preservation approaches.
Procedure Details
During the procedure, excess skin is removed, and the nipple and areola are repositioned to create a more lifted, symmetrical appearance. For patients desiring additional volume, breast implants can be simultaneously inserted either under breast tissue or chest wall muscle.
Recovery and Healing
Post-operative recovery emphasizes rest and limited movement to expedite healing. Patients will initially wear surgical bandages, followed by a specialized surgical bra for several weeks. Minor discomfort can typically be managed with prescribed oral medication.
